Netherlands seal Olympic Games 2024 Qualification
The EuroHockey Championships 2023 came to an end today with Netherlands claiming the women’s and men’s title and securing direct qualification to the Olympic Games Paris 2024. Netherlands women were the reigning champions and defended their title against Belgium in the finals, to lift the continental championship, for a record 12th time! Dutch men followed suit, defending their EuroHockey title, in a tense final against England.

Men's EuroHockey Championship 2023: Statistical Review
By Tariq Ali
Netherlands men's hockey team also won the Gold Medal in the Men's EuroHockey Championship 2023 defeated England by 2-1 in final at Warsteiner Hockey Park, Monchengladbach, Germany.
Belgium defeated the host Germany by 2-0 to win the Bronze Medal.
Final Standing of Men's EuroHockey Championship 2023:
1 Netherlands 2 England 3 Belgium 4 Germany 5 France 6 Spain 7 Austria 8 Wales
Result Summary:
Teams Played Won Lost Drawn GF. GA
1 NED. 5. 4. 0. 1. 19. 7
2 ENG. 5. 2. 2. 1. 11. 9
3 BEL. 5. 4. 0. 1. 17. 8
4 GER. 5. 2. 1. 2. 10. 6
5 FRA. 5. 3. 2. 0. 9. 14
6 ESP. 5. 2. 3. 0. 14. 14
7 AUT. 5. 1. 4. 0. 8. 16
8 WAL. 5. 0. 4. 1. 8. 21
Highest Match Scores:
Netherlands 8-1 Wales
Netherlands 6-0 France
Spain 5-0 Austria
Belgium 5-1 Spain
Belgium 5-3 England
Hat trick Scorers:
3 goals - Etienne Tynevez (France)
Top Scorers:
6 goals - Duco Telgenkamp (Netherlands)
5 goals - Florent van Aubel (Belgium)
5 goals - Alexander Hendrickx (Belgium)

Indian Women’s Hockey Team defeats Thailand 5-4 in Women’s Asian Hockey 5s World Cup Qualifier
Navjot Kaur, Monika Dipi Toppo, Mahima Choudhary and Ajmina Kujur were on target for the Indian Women’s Hockey Team
Oman: The Indian Women’s Hockey Team defeated Thailand 5-4 in Salalah, Oman, on Sunday at the Women’s Asian Hockey 5s World Cup Qualifier. For India, Navjot Kaur (1’), Monika Dipi Toppo (1’,7’), Mahima Choudhary (20’) and Ajmina Kujur (30’) were on target. For Thailand, Piresram Anongnat (3’), Aunjai Natthakarn (10’, 14’) and Suwapat Konthong (19’) were on target.

Indian Men's Hockey Team eyes strong start in Men's Asian Hockey 5s World Cup Qualifier
The Indian Men's Hockey Team will face off against Bangladesh in their first match
Oman: The Indian Men's Hockey Team will begin their campaign at the Men's Asian Hockey 5s World Cup Qualifier against Bangladesh in Salalah, Oman on Monday, August 29th. The tournament is scheduled to take place from 29th August to 2nd September. India are placed in the Elite Pool along with Malaysia, Pakistan, Japan, Oman, and Bangladesh, while the Challengers Pool consists of Hong Kong China, Indonesia, Afghanistan, Kazakhstan, and Iran.

PHF embroiled in another controversy
PHF canceled the extraordinary Congress meeting set to be held in Islamabad on
By Abdul Mohi Shah
Pakistan hockey team in action - PHF
ISLAMABAD: Controversy erupted on Saturday following a press release issued by the Pakistan Hockey Federation (PHF) stating that suspended president Brig Khalid Khokhar has canceled the extraordinary Congress meeting set to be held in Islamabad on August 31 and reinstated himself and all federation office-bearers without seeking a vote of confidence.

Tar Heels Fall To Iowa In OT Field Hockey Battle
CHAPEL HILL, N.C. – The North Carolina field hockey team suffered its first loss of the season on Sunday, falling at home to No. 7 Iowa 3-2 in overtime. The game winner from Lieve van Kessel, on a shot from just inside the arc, came 1:41 into extra time.

No. 3 Maryland field hockey pulls away late, defeats Cal, 4-1
The Terps improved to 2-0 on the year.
By Ryan-Martin
Maryland field hockey was tied with Cal late, but pulled away in the fourth quarter to move to 2-0 on the season. Photo courtesy of Maryland Athletics.
No. 3 Maryland field hockey found itself tied with Cal and in danger of being upset entering the fourth quarter Sunday afternoon. But as the final period waned, Maryland began to collect penalty corners and finally netted the game-winner with just over six minutes to play when Hope Rose buried a shot into the corner of the goal.
